# North Carolina Republican Party Chair Michael Whatley Appointed to Lead RNC ## RNC Appoints Michael Whatley as New National Chairman ### Michael Whatley, Chair of the North Carolina Republican Party, has been named the new chair of the Republican National Committee (RNC).
The RNC voted earlier this year to appoint Whatley as its new leader. Whatley's appointment comes as the RNC prepares for the 2024 presidential election.
Ronna McDaniel, the outgoing RNC chairwoman, announced her resignation earlier this year. McDaniel had served as RNC chairwoman since 2017.
Whatley is a veteran Republican Party operative. He has served as Chair of the North Carolina Republican Party since 2019. Whatley is also a former member of the Republican National Committee.
In his new role as RNC chair, Whatley will be responsible for leading the party's efforts to win the 2024 presidential election. He will also be responsible for fundraising for the party and recruiting candidates to run for office.
The RNC is the governing body of the Republican Party. The RNC is responsible for setting the party's platform, electing its national officers, and fundraising for the party's candidates.
